標題:Linux chage命令:管理用戶密碼策略的利器
在Linux系統中,保護用戶賬戶安全是至關重要的一項任務。密碼策略的管理是確保賬戶安全的重要措施之一。在Linux系統中,可以使用chage命令來管理用戶密碼策略。本文將詳細介紹如何使用chage命令來管理用戶密碼策略,包括密碼過期時間、最小更改間隔、密碼到期前警告天數等參數的設置,并提供具體的代碼示例。
1. chage命令簡介
chage命令用于修改用戶賬號的密碼到期信息。通過chage命令,可以設置用戶密碼的過期時間、最小更改間隔、密碼到期前警告天數等參數。chage命令的基本語法如下:
chage [options] username
登錄后復制
2. chage命令常用選項
-m, –mindays MIN_DAYS:設置用戶修改密碼的最小間隔天數。-M, –maxdays MAX_DAYS:設置用戶密碼的最長有效期。-W, –warndays WARN_DAYS:設置在密碼過期前多少天提醒用戶修改密碼。-E, –expiredate EXPIRE_DATE:設置用戶密碼的過期日期。-l, –list:顯示用戶密碼過期信息。-d, –lastday LAST_DAY:設置最近一次密碼更改日期。
3. chage命令示例
3.1 設置密碼最長有效期
要設置用戶密碼的最長有效期,可以使用-M選項,例如:
sudo chage -M 90 username
登錄后復制
這會將用戶”username”的密碼最長有效期設置為90天。
3.2 設置密碼過期前的提醒天數
要設置密碼過期前的提醒天數,可以使用-W選項,例如:
sudo chage -W 7 username
登錄后復制
這會在用戶”username”的密碼過期前7天提醒用戶修改密碼。
3.3 設置密碼的過期日期
要設置用戶密碼的過期日期,可以使用-E選項,例如:
sudo chage -E "2022-12-31" username
登錄后復制
這會將用戶”username”的密碼設置為2022年12月31日過期。
4. 查看用戶密碼過期信息
要查看用戶密碼的過期信息,可以使用-l選項,例如:
sudo chage -l username
登錄后復制
這將顯示用戶”username”的密碼過期信息,包括最近一次密碼更改日期、密碼過期日期等。
5. 總結
通過使用chage命令,我們可以靈活管理用戶密碼策略,包括設置密碼的最長有效期、密碼過期前的提醒天數等。合理設置密碼策略可以提高系統安全性,保護用戶賬戶的安全。希望本文能幫助您更好地了解如何使用chage命令管理用戶密碼策略。